mdsk.net
当前位置:首页 >> 希尔排序空间复杂度 >>

希尔排序空间复杂度

求希尔排序的时间空间复杂度。。。还有要是可能的话给讲解(不好意思。。没解释出来)空间复杂度是O(1) 因为只有一个缓冲单元。希望对你有帮助。希尔排序的算法:Void ShellInsert(Sq:

为什么希尔排序的空间复杂度为O(1),这个是怎么理解的希尔排序是插入排序的改良版,插入排序空间复杂度就是O1,因为每次就是拿起一个数比较。快速排序空间复杂度说的是 维持这个哨兵元素

希尔排序的时间复杂度--CSDN问答最坏情况O(N^2)。

使用希尔增量的希尔排序的时间复杂度为什么是O(N^2)而希尔排序是插入排序的变种(优化),插入排序最坏时间复杂度才是O(n^2)。

下列四种排序中( )的空间复杂度最大.(A) 快速排序 (B快排不用递归写就不怎么费空间了吧,希尔排序法可以写成logn的空间复杂度吧,堆排序排序元素个

希尔排序法时间复杂度O是什么意思?O表示是描述一个算法在问题规模不断增大时对应的时间增长曲线。

希尔排序时间复杂度O(n.)中的1.3是怎么来的?_百度1、首先希尔排序是一种递减增量的排序算法,下面使用大小为9的数组:54、26、93、17、31、44、55、20。2、令数据间隔为3,将

冒泡排序、希尔排序、快速排序、堆排序空间复杂度最大空间复杂度所需辅助空间的大小,所以是归并排序,为O(n)。

中各种排序的时间复杂度与空间复杂度比较!希尔排序是不稳定的,其时间复杂度为O(n ^2)。 排序类别 时间复杂度 空间复杂度 稳定 1 插入排序 O(n2) 1 √ 2 希尔排序

下列四种排序中( )的空间复杂度最大。 (A) 快速排序 (B冒泡排序属于简单排序,只需要几个辅助循环变量,因此为O(1)希尔排序,只是将直接插入排序进行修改,一般不设置特别的缩小增量序列,

相关文档
fnhp.net | zxqk.net | zxqs.net | fpbl.net | sichuansong.com | 网站首页 | 网站地图
All rights reserved Powered by www.mdsk.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com